[In the Media] “Strengthening Response Capabilities to Infectious Diseases through Collaboration between Communities and Businesses” (The Nikkei, November 27, 2023)
date : 12/12/2023
Tags: Vaccinations
A comment by Health and Global Policy Institute (HGPI) Vice President Mr. Joji Sugawara’s comments at “Breakout Session D: Significance and Challenges of Infectious Diseases Control in Companies” held during the 10th NIKKEI FT Communicable Diseases Conference (hosted by Nikkei Inc. and co-hosted by the Financial Times) was featured in the November 27 print edition of the Nikkei.
The article addresses the fundamental contribution of immunization as a countermeasure against infectious diseases, the importance of a life-course approach to immunization policy, and the role of private companies and industries in the National Immunization Plan, based on the discussions and policy recommendations from HGPI’s immunization and vaccine policies projects.
